Course details


Autonomous Vehicle Perception: This unit focuses on the sensors and software that enable autonomous vehicles to perceive and understand their environment, including lidar, radar, cameras, and ultrasonic sensors. •
Machine Learning for Autonomous Vehicles: This unit explores the application of machine learning algorithms to enable autonomous vehicles to make decisions and take actions, including computer vision, natural language processing, and predictive modeling. •
Autonomous Vehicle Control Systems: This unit delves into the control systems that enable autonomous vehicles to navigate and control their movements, including sensor fusion, motion planning, and control algorithms. •
Autonomous Vehicle Safety and Security: This unit addresses the critical issues of safety and security in autonomous vehicles, including cybersecurity threats, sensor reliability, and human-machine interface design. •
Autonomous Vehicle Regulations and Standards: This unit examines the regulatory frameworks and standards that govern the development and deployment of autonomous vehicles, including federal and state regulations, industry standards, and international harmonization. •
Autonomous Vehicle Testing and Validation: This unit focuses on the testing and validation processes that ensure autonomous vehicles meet safety and performance standards, including simulation testing, track testing, and real-world testing. •
Autonomous Vehicle Business Models and Economics: This unit explores the business models and economic factors that drive the development and deployment of autonomous vehicles, including cost-benefit analysis, return on investment, and market competition. •
Autonomous Vehicle Communication and Networking: This unit addresses the communication and networking requirements of autonomous vehicles, including vehicle-to-vehicle (V2V) and vehicle-to-infrastructure (V2I) communication, as well as data analytics and cloud computing. •
Autonomous Vehicle Human-Machine Interface: This unit examines the human-machine interface design for autonomous vehicles, including user experience, user interface, and voice recognition and natural language processing. •
Autonomous Vehicle Ethics and Society: This unit explores the ethical and societal implications of autonomous vehicles, including job displacement, liability, and social responsibility, as well as the need for public education and awareness.

Career path

**Career Role** Description
Software Engineer Design, develop, and test software applications for autonomous vehicles, ensuring they meet safety and performance standards.
Data Scientist Analyze data from various sources to improve autonomous vehicle systems, including sensor data, GPS, and mapping information.
Autonomous Vehicle Engineer Design, develop, and test autonomous vehicle systems, ensuring they meet safety and performance standards.
Computer Vision Engineer Develop algorithms and software for computer vision applications in autonomous vehicles, including object detection and tracking.
Machine Learning Engineer Develop and implement machine learning models for autonomous vehicle applications, including predictive maintenance and anomaly detection.
